The Basics of Branded Dropshipping Suppliers

Branded dropshipping suppliers are essentially companies that allow retailers to sell their products without holding inventory. This model is appealing because it minimizes risk and upfront costs. However, navigating the legal landscape can be tricky. One major aspect to consider is Intellectual Property Rights (IPR). When you’re selling branded products, understanding IPR becomes crucial since unauthorized use can lead to serious legal repercussions.

Diving into Dropship from China and Intellectual Property Rights

If you’re considering dropship from china, it’s essential to grasp how IPR plays a role in this process. Many Chinese manufacturers produce goods under various brand names; however, not all have permission for trademark usage. Selling these items could potentially infringe on someone else’s intellectual property rights if proper licenses aren’t obtained or verified beforehand. So before diving headfirst into sourcing products from China, make sure you’re well-informed about who owns what!
